1. Energy Efficiency & Renewable Power

Advanced Energy Management Systems
Building owners are increasingly turning to AI-driven energy management systems to optimize energy consumption in real-time. These systems analyze usage patterns and adjust HVAC, lighting, and other utilities for maximum efficiency.
Solar & On-Site Renewable Energy
More educational institutions are installing solar panels, battery storage, and microgrid systems to generate clean, renewable power on-site. Net metering programs allow buildings to sell excess energy back to the grid, reducing electricity costs.
High-Performance Building Materials
Innovations like heat-reflective roofing, smart windows, and high-performance insulation help regulate indoor temperatures, reducing reliance on heating and cooling systems.

2. Smart Building Technology & Automation

IoT-Enabled Sensors
Facilities are increasingly integrating IoT (Internet of Things) sensors to automate lighting, HVAC systems, and occupancy monitoring. These systems help reduce unnecessary energy usage and improve efficiency.
Digital Twins & Predictive Maintenance
Digital twin technology creates a virtual model of a building to monitor real-time conditions and predict maintenance needs. This prevents unexpected equipment failures and extends asset lifespan.
AI-Driven Waste Reduction
Artificial intelligence is being used to track and optimize waste management. Smart bins can sort recyclables automatically, and AI analytics help facilities identify opportunities to reduce waste.

3. Water Conservation & Waste Reduction

Smart Water Systems
Automated leak detection, weather-based irrigation, and greywater recycling systems are becoming standard in sustainable facilities. These innovations help conserve water without compromising daily operations.
Zero-Waste Initiatives
Recycling programs and composting efforts are expanding in commercial spaces. Facilities are setting ambitious zero-waste goals to reduce landfill contributions and promote responsible waste management.
Eco-Friendly Cleaning Solutions
Green cleaning products are gaining popularity as institutions prioritize the health of students and staff. Non-toxic, biodegradable cleaning agents improve indoor air quality while reducing environmental impact.

4. Health, Wellness, & Indoor Air Quality

WELL Building Standards Expansion
Improved air filtration, ventilation, and other wellness-focused upgrades are becoming critical components of facility management. Schools and universities are enhancing indoor air quality (IAQ) to create healthier learning environments.
Biophilic Design & Green Spaces
Natural lighting, indoor plants, and green walls are being incorporated into facility designs to boost mood, reduce stress, and improve overall well-being.
Low-VOC & Non-Toxic Materials
The demand for non-toxic paints, carpets, and furniture is increasing, as these materials reduce indoor air pollutants and contribute to a healthier space.

5. Sustainable Certifications & Compliance

LEED & ESG Compliance
More facilities are pursuing L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design) certification to validate their sustainability efforts. 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) compliance is also becoming a priority for building owners looking to meet investor and regulatory expectations.
Government Incentives & Regulations
New sustainability regulations and tax credits are encouraging facility managers to adopt greener practices. Staying ahead of these changes helps institutions avoid fines and maximize financial benefits.
Transparency in Sustainability Reporting
Public disclosure of sustainability metrics, carbon footprints, and environmental impact assessments is becoming a standard expectation in commercial real estate.
